Spring is also tricky since the large amount of snowmelt creates extreme flows that can damage bridges and trails, which will need to be fixed by a trail crew before visitors can safely pass. The highest point in the trail is at 6,750 feet (Panhandle Gap), which doesnt melt out until late June or early July, so hikers attempting the route before midsummer will need to be prepared for snow travel.
